The Undergate (also called the under-gate) was a gate with brazen doors that blocked the entrance from the underground side passage that was called the Under-way to the ground floor of the Tower of Cirith Ungol.[1][2]
When Frodo and Sam first encountered the Under-way they were in darkness and only perceived that the way was blocked. After Frodo had been stung by Shelob[3], orcs found Frodo and carried the unconscious Frodo through the Under-way and through the Undergate to the Tower of Cirith Ungol. Sam followed the orcs on the Under-way, but was unable to get through the locked Undergate and was forced to go back to the main tunnel in Shelob's Lair.[2]
